Ticket: DocSweep linter release 2.4.1 fails signature verification in CI. The pipeline rejects the tarball because the detached signature was produced with the retired 2023 key, while the verifier only trusts the current one. Rebuilding with the updated toolchain fixes it locally. Reviewer: please confirm the verifier config matches. For reference, the trusted signing key is below.

rollout seal: bky4_x7Gc

**Q: Why do exported reports show different times than the dashboard?**

Brightlume exports always render in UTC; the dashboard uses the viewer's browser zone. This is expected. Do not advise customers to change account settings — it only affects email digests. If a customer insists timestamps are wrong by a non-whole-hour offset, escalate to the Kestrelware data team, since that indicates a DST bug in the export worker. Escalation requires unlocking the shared diagnostics vault, which accepts only the recovery passphrase below.

strongbox words: zorwyn-sorael-belion-ulaius-silmir-ulays-briax-rusdor-gorix

## Step 4 — Reconfigure the renderer

Okay, SeatScape v3 drops the old XML layout files for the Almont Playhouse seat maps. Delete the legacy layouts directory, then regenerate from the house plan. The renderer won't start until its settings match the new schema, so update them now to the following values.

deployment values, yadug-bawif:
[framir]
team = pelox
access_code = ac_a38ab2
owner = tamion.julael
host = framir.tolvaqlabs.test
port = 11211
peer = tammir.zemvargrid.local
salt = 2215ef03
pin = 1541